India
Could not determine your location, go to the directory and select the city manually.
Go to
Information about Indian companies
Privacy Policy
Search
Home
WB
Panchla
Resort
Resort in Panchla Region
Country Roads
Village Raghudevpur, Opposite Raghudevpur Gram Panchayat Office, Domjur - Bauria Road, Howrah, West Bengal 711322, India